π₯ Mixed Grill Tradition
The Lebanese Mashawi β or mixed grill β comes from a long tradition of feasting.
Families would gather and share platters of chicken, beef, and lamb cooked over charcoal flames. π’
At Michoz, our Mixed Grill keeps that same spirit alive β perfectly seasoned, grilled to perfection, and made to share.

π The Rich History of Lebanese Food β Now at Michoz πΏ
Lebanese cuisine is one of the worldβs oldest culinary traditions, shaped by thousands of years of history and cultural exchange. Rooted in the fertile lands of the Mediterranean, it combines fresh vegetables, grains, herbs, and spices with slow-cooked meats, creating dishes that are both healthy and bursting with flavor.
Some of Lebanonβs most popular foods have stood the test of time and made their way onto the Michoz menu:
π₯ Pita & Hummus β A staple of the Middle East for centuries, this simple yet flavorful pairing remains one of the most loved starters worldwide.
π₯ Falafel β Made from chickpeas and herbs, falafel is a plant-based powerhouse thatβs been enjoyed since ancient times.
π₯© Kabobs β Grilled over open flames by travelers and nomads, kabobs bring history to life with every perfectly seasoned bite.
π₯ Gyros & Shawarma β Though rooted in different parts of the Mediterranean, both dishes highlight the art of slow-cooked, spiced meats wrapped in warm pita.
At Michoz, weβre proud to bring these timeless dishes to San Diego, honoring tradition while serving them fresh every day. When you dine with us, youβre not just enjoying a meal β youβre experiencing centuries of Lebanese culture on a plate.

π₯ The Rise of Shawarma
Centuries ago, Middle Eastern cooks mastered the art of slow-roasting meat on vertical spits β and shawarma was born. π₯
Tender, spiced beef and chicken sliced to perfection β itβs Lebanonβs most famous street food.
At Michoz, we serve it the traditional way β juicy, bold, unforgettable.

Lebanese restaurants are known for their authentic and flavorful dishes, and Micho'z Fresh Lebanese Grill on University Avenue in San Diego is no exception. This restaurant prides itself on providing customers with high-quality food that is made fresh from scratch. The menu offers a variety of delicious options, including chicken shawarma, falafels, manakeesh, pies off the sajj, rakakat (cheese fingers), tabouli, and kabobs off the grill.
One of the standout dishes at Micho'z is the chicken shawarma - it's juicy and full of flavor. The falafels are also a must-try as they are made from scratch and have a perfect crispy texture. Additionally, Micho'z serves beer and wine to complement your meal.
